**MEYPEARL HARMONY PHÚ QUỐC: AWARD-WINNING SEASIDE DEVELOPMENT**
PropertyGuru Vietnam Awards 2024: Best Coastal Residential Development
On November 15, in Ho Chi Minh City, PropertyGuru, Southeast Asia’s leading property technology company, announced the winners of the 2024 PropertyGuru Vietnam Property Awards.
Among the recipients was the Meypearl Harmony Phu Quoc project, developed by Tan A Dai Thanh – Meyland. This beachfront condominium project impressed the judges with its unique offering of long-term ownership and a rare collection of yacht-inspired apartments.

Meypearl Harmony Phu Quoc excelled in one of the most competitive categories, meeting the stringent criteria set by the organizers. Their win is a testament to the project’s exceptional value and the positive impact it will have on the island.
According to the judging panel, Meypearl Harmony Phu Quoc not only maximizes its advantageous location on Truong Beach, the longest and most pristine beach on the island, but also offers a unique collection of yacht-inspired apartments that cater to both residential and investment needs. The project boasts a solid legal foundation, a reputable developer, and a sustainable development strategy inherited from the top-tier Meyhomes Capital Phu Quoc urban area.
A RARE COLLECTION OF LONG-TERM OWNERSHIP SEASIDE APARTMENTS IN PHU QUOC
Spanning an area of 17,409 square meters, Meypearl Harmony introduces over 1,000 yacht-style apartments, making it the only long-term ownership beachfront condominium project along Truong Beach’s coastline. It is also located within the limited 6% urban development land allocation of the island city.

Meypearl Harmony enjoys a dynamic connectivity with four major road frontages: Dai Lo Anh Sao, Duong Hoa Su, Duong Huynh Anh, and Duong Hai Duong. It provides direct access to Truong Beach’s coastal road, the largest on the island, and the “billion-dollar road” linking Truong Beach to other key areas. Residents can easily reach all important destinations on the island within a 20-minute drive.
As part of the prestigious Meyhomes Capital Phu Quoc urban area, spanning over 300 hectares, Meypearl Harmony inherits the best living conditions from its well-planned smart city design, modern technical infrastructure, high-quality living standards, and a civilized and distinguished community. It is poised to become the new economic and administrative center of the island city in the future.
Within a 2km radius of the project, residents will have access to a comprehensive range of amenities catering to their daily needs, including education, entertainment, and administrative services. Notable mentions include the An Thoi Public Administration Center, the Meyschool Doan Thi Diem School, a sports center, a commercial center, the Bien Ngoc Square, the Koradise Korean Street, the Ice Jungle Art Light Park, the 5-star Grand Mercure Hotel, and an international convention center.

Additionally, residents of Meypearl Harmony will indulge in a 5-star lifestyle with 78 internal well-living themed amenities, a first for Phu Quoc. These include 8,300 square meters of green landscapes, the highest sky garden in Truong Beach, a 50-meter pearl-shaped swimming pool, interconnected gardens and walking paths, children’s playgrounds and pools, and a state-of-the-art gym and spa for the ultimate self-care experience.
